如何将Arduino Nano和Neo-6M GPS模块整合进一个便携式天文观测装置中,并利用OLED显示屏实时展示GPS定位数据?
时间: 2024-11-19 18:29:22 浏览: 27
要创建一个便携式天文观测装置,你需要将Arduino Nano作为主控制器,Neo-6M GPS模块作为定位核心,以及0.96英寸OLED I2C显示屏来实时展示GPS定位数据。以下步骤将指导你如何一步步构建这个装置:
参考资源链接:[Arduino Nano DIY:低成本天文学GPS模块开发教程](https://wenku.csdn.net/doc/45wfq67cwk?spm=1055.2569.3001.10343)
1. **硬件准备**:确保你已经准备了Arduino Nano开发板、Neo-6M GPS模块、OLED显示屏以及必要的接线材料。
2. **组装硬件**:首先,将GPS模块通过串口与Arduino Nano连接起来,并将OLED显示屏通过I2C接口连接到Nano板的对应接口上。根据《Arduino Nano DIY:低成本天文学GPS模块开发教程》的硬件部分,仔细操作,以保证连接的正确性。
3. **上传代码**:使用Arduino IDE上传控制代码到Nano板。该代码应包括处理GPS数据的逻辑以及将数据展示在OLED屏幕上的功能。你可以参考教程中的操作步骤进行操作。
4. **校准和测试**:在户外开启GPS模块,确保它能够接收到足够数量的卫星信号,然后通过串口监视器查看获取到的位置信息。同时,观察OLED显示屏是否能够正确地展示这些数据。
5. **封装装置**:当你确认装置能够正常工作后,可以按照提供的外壳设计图来制作装置的外壳。如果你更倾向于DIY,可以使用Fritzing等软件来设计自己的PCB板,并进行封装。
6. **使用软件辅助**:最后,你可以使用教程中提到的辅助软件如AstroPlanner或myGPSWin来进一步提升你的天文学观测体验。
通过上述步骤,你就能成功构建一个便携式天文观测装置,实时追踪并展示你的地理位置信息,这将对户外天文观测带来极大的便利。如果你希望进一步深入学习关于Arduino Nano、GPS模块以及OLED显示屏的更多内容,建议参阅《Arduino Nano DIY:低成本天文学GPS模块开发教程》。这份全面的指南不仅涵盖了当前项目的实施步骤,还提供了丰富的项目知识和技巧,帮助你成为更加专业的DIY爱好者。
参考资源链接:[Arduino Nano DIY:低成本天文学GPS模块开发教程](https://wenku.csdn.net/doc/45wfq67cwk?spm=1055.2569.3001.10343)
阅读全文